You can add the audio after taking a picture.
Select [AUDIO DUB.] on the [PLAYBACK] mode menu. (P20)
Press 2/1 to select the picture and then press
[MENU/SET] to start audio recording.
The message [OVERWRITE AUDIO DATA?] screen appears
when audio has already been recorded. Press 3 to select [YES]
and then press [MENU/SET] to start audio recording. (The
original audio is overwritten.)
Audio is recorded from the built-in microphone on the camera.
If you press [‚], the audio dubbing is canceled.
Press [MENU/SET] to stop recording.
It will automatically stop after recording about 10 seconds without
pressing [MENU/SET].
Press [‚] to return to the menu screen.
Press [MENU/SET] to close the menu.
Note
Audio dubbing may not work properly on pictures recorded by other equipment.
Audio dubbing does not work on motion pictures and protected pictures.
Sound from motion pictures or pictures with audio recorded by this camera cannot be played
back by older models of Panasonic digital camera (LUMIX) launched before July 2008.
All the information regarding the [FACE RECOG.] of the selected image will be cleared.
Select [FACE RECOG.] on the [PLAYBACK] mode menu. (P20)
Press 2/1 to select the picture and then press [MENU/SET]
Press 3 to select [YES] and then press [MENU/SET].
Press [‚] to return to the menu screen.
Press [MENU/SET] to close the menu.
Note
Cleared information regarding the [FACE RECOG.] cannot be restored.
Images Cleared of [FACE RECOG.] will not be categorized for [CATEGORY PLAY].
Clearing of [FACE RECOG.] cannot be done on a protected image.
